Budget Web Hosting: Your Online Home

Looking to launch your website without breaking the bank? Shared web hosting offers a cost-effective solution, allowing you to share server resources with other sites. It's a great choice for new businesses who are just starting out or those looking for a simple way to get online.

  • Advantages of Shared Web Hosting include:
  • Affordability: Shared hosting plans are typically cheaper than other types of web hosting.
  • User-Friendliness: Most shared hosting providers offer user-friendly control panels and features that make it easy to manage your website.
  • Technical Support : Reputable shared hosting companies provide responsive technical support to help you with any issues.

With its popularity, shared web hosting remains a top choice for individuals and businesses of all sizes.

Hosting Plans: Is It Right for You?

Shared hosting is known to be a common choice for website publishers. It offers a affordable way to establish your website on the web. However, there are some pros and more info cons that before making a decision.

On the positive side, shared hosting is highly affordable, often costing just a few dollars per month. It's also user-friendly and demands little technical expertise.

However, shared hosting does some limitations. Because your platform shares bandwidth with other websites, its load time might be affected by the activities of neighbouring sites. This might result in slow loading times or even downtime, which can harm your website's standing.

Moreover, shared hosting offers restricted resources. This means that you have limited storage space, bandwidth, and other resources.

Ultimately, the decision of whether or not to choose shared hosting relies on your individual requirements. If you're just starting out, shared hosting may be a good option. However, if you require advanced features, you would be better off with a different type of hosting, such as VPS or dedicated hosting.
